The Production of Olive Oil, plate 13 from Nova Reperta - A Glimpse into the Ancient Art of Harvesting Liquid Gold

EDITORS COMMENTS
. This print transports us back in time to witness the age-old process of olive oil production. Plate 13 from Nova Reperta, a series of engravings created by Philip Galle around 1600, offers a fascinating glimpse into this labor-intensive industry. In this scene captured by Jan van der Straet (Giovanni Stradano), we see peasants diligently working amidst an idyllic countryside backdrop. The image showcases the various stages involved in transforming olives into liquid gold – from harvesting and pressing to milling and storing. A donkey and mule stand patiently nearby, their presence essential for transporting heavy loads of olives or freshly pressed oil. Jars filled with precious golden elixir line the scene, symbolizing both abundance and prosperity. The hardworking laborers are depicted with meticulous detail, highlighting their dedication to this ancient craft. Their weathered faces tell stories of generations who have passed down these traditional methods through centuries. This enchanting print not only captures a moment frozen in time but also serves as a reminder that behind every bottle of olive oil lies a rich history rooted in human ingenuity and perseverance. It is an homage to those who have dedicated their lives to perfecting this timeless art form - one that continues to nourish our bodies and enrich our culinary experiences today.
